Output e6f84c612d59e8fff74578f405710d1466d069f8798f3f412fcd4593a4c02f81:45

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 102587e1f30ae49f531716f00337ece78d633d7f OP_EQUALVERIFY OP_CHECKSIG
address
D6cUK1hRWaUXzg2Bw8HewXCVN7EkJYXHQE
transaction
e6f84c612d59e8fff74578f405710d1466d069f8798f3f412fcd4593a4c02f81